Like many other services, Outlook also provides dark mode. It changes the default bright background color to a black background, which protects eyes in low-light environments. If you often work in such environments, this feature would be quite useful for you.
In Outlook for Microsoft 365, the black color theme includes dark mode, which provides a black background (instead of white) for the message window. You can switch to a white background for the message window if you prefer. Switch to black theme. Dark mode is enabled by default when you use the black theme .

Does Windows 10 have a dark mode for Excel?
Windows 10’s system-wide dark mode won’t affect Office apps, but you can choose a dark theme for Office apps like Microsoft Word, Excel, Outlook, and Power, and point. According to Microsoft, Office’s dark mode is only available if you have a Microsoft 365 (previously known as Office 365) subscription.
How do I turn dark mode on or off when reading messages?
When reading a message, you can turn dark mode on or off by using the icon at the top of the message window. Select the sun icon to change the message window background to white. Select the moon icon to change the message window background to black.
